Requirements
You can only activate tool monitoring if the tool-specific grinding data $TC_TPG1 to
$TC_TPG9 (see /PGA/Programming Guide "Advanced") are set.
According to the machine data settings, tool monitoring for the grinding tools (types 400-499)
can be automatically activated when the tool selection is activated.
Only one monitoring routine can be active at any one time for each spindle.
Geometry monitoring
The current wheel radius and the current width are monitored.
The set speed is monitored against the speed limitation cyclically with allowance for the
spindle override.
The speed limit is the smaller value resulting from a comparison of the maximum speed with
the speed calculated from the maximum wheel peripheral speed and the current wheel
radius.
